Looking in Disk Inventory X, in ~/Library/Caches, there is a folder
called Adobe Camera Raw (app I don't use) and which contains 169 files
with names along the lines of 'Cache00000000081.dat', which are Mac
Wavelets WBIN documents.

Nearly a gig's worth - can I delete them?

Martin S. - 04 May 2008 12:03 GMT
> Ah, thanks!  But are they important?  I've deleted them now!

I think they are just rendered previews of images you've been editing.
Leaving them would speed up display of those images, but they're
certainly not vital. LR will generate them again as needed.
